Overview
Testing cells, batteries and components for electric vehicles in order to develop architectures
Skills
Learnt what it means to take responsibility for projects which you are leading/are involved in. Furthermore, I learned how to communicate with teams from different countries during international projects
Responsibilities
Yes, within the first few days I volunteered and was able to lead an international project which would span over the next 8 months
Support & Guidance
Lots of support with 1 on 1 sessions with my manager, and they give you a buddy which helps you to settle in to the company
Culture
Calm and relaxing
Your Impressions
I enjoyed my placement a lot
Yes
Enjoy your time while you are here. Try and get involved with everything that you can to maximise what you get out of the placement.
